Yes, you can smoke at Saratov Gagarin International Airport (GSV), outdoors. The terminal has no enclosed indoor smoking room and no confirmed airside smoking area; smoke at the designated points outside the terminal, away from the entrances, before you go through security.
Gagarin International Airport (IATA: GSV; ICAO: UWSG) opened in August 2019 and replaced the old Saratov Tsentralny Airport (RTW), which closed the same month. It is a modern single-terminal airport about 20 km north of Saratov.
Where to Smoke
Like several modern Russian airports, the Gagarin terminal does not provide an enclosed indoor smoking room, and there is no confirmed smoking area after security. Smoke at the designated points outside the terminal, away from the doors, before you pass through screening. Under Russian law, smoking is banned inside the terminal and close to the entrances.
Vaping
E-cigarettes and vapes fall under the same rules as cigarettes: outdoor designated areas only, never inside the terminal.
